Introduction
Website design and development is the process of creating a website. It involves a wide range of skills, including graphic design, web development, and content creation. Web designers focus on the look and feel of a website, while web developers focus on how it functions.
Web Design
Web design is the process of creating a visual representation of a website. It involves creating wireframes and mockups to define the layout and structure of the website. Web designers also choose the colors, fonts, and images that will be used on the website.
Some of the key elements of web design include:
- Layout: The layout of a website refers to the arrangement of the different elements on the page, such as the header, footer, navigation, and content area.
- Typography: Typography refers to the use of fonts on a website. Web designers choose fonts that are easy to read and visually appealing.
- Color scheme: The color scheme of a website is the set of colors that are used throughout the site. Web designers choose colors that create a cohesive and visually appealing look and feel.
- Imagery: Imagery can be used to add visual interest to a website and to communicate information. Web designers choose images that are high quality and relevant to the content of the website.
Web Development
Web development is the process of coding and building a website. Web developers use programming languages such as HTML, CSS, and JavaScript to create the structure and functionality of a website.
Some of the key elements of web development include:
- Front-end development: Front-end development refers to the code that is used to create the user interface of a website. This includes the elements that users see and interact with, such as the buttons, menus, and forms.
- Back-end development: Back-end development refers to the code that is used to create the server-side of a website. This includes the code that is used to store and process data, and to generate the pages that users see.
- Database development: Database development refers to the process of creating and managing a database to store the data that is used on a website. This data can include anything from product information to user accounts.
Website Design & Development Process
The website design and development process typically involves the following steps:
- Planning: The first step is to plan the website. This includes defining the goals of the website, identifying the target audience, and creating a content outline.
- Design: Once the plan is in place, the web designer will create wireframes and mockups to define the layout and structure of the website.
- Development: Once the design is approved, the web developer will code and build the website. This includes creating the front-end and back-end of the website, and integrating the database.
- Testing: Once the website is built, it needs to be tested to ensure that it works properly and that it is user-friendly.
- Launch: Once the website is tested and approved, it can be launched. This involves making the website live on the internet.
Conclusion
Website design and development is a complex process, but it is essential for any business that wants to have a presence online. A well-designed and developed website can help businesses to reach their target audience, promote their products or services, and generate leads.
If you are interested in learning more about website design and development, there are a number of resources available online and in libraries. You can also find many courses and tutorials that can teach you the skills you need to create your own website.